About Vincent

Vincent, Alabama is home to 2 public schools, with combined enrollment of approximately 844 students. By school count, it is a rural-scale city.

Looking at the level breakdown, the city covers 1 elementary, and 1 high.

Average school size in Vincent is around 422 students, 22% below the Alabama average of about 544.

Over the past 7-year window. Across the same 7-year window, public-school enrollment fell 3%: 872 students in SY 2017-18 versus 844 in SY 2024-25.
